The Port of Rotterdam Authority as well as inland delivery driver Port Lining authorized an agreement for the building of a billing as well as storage space pontoon for circulation batteries in the Hartelkanaal.
From this bunkering terminal, Port Lining will provide electrically powered inland vessels with circulation batteries. Construction is readied to start in the 4th quarter of this year, with conclusion of the Netherlands’ very first electrolyte bunkering terminal anticipated in Q1 of 2024.

Flow batteries
Together with companions Vattenfall as well as Greenchoice, Port Lining has actually created the idea for zero-emission delivery based upon circulation batteries. In circulation batteries, electrical power is butted in a fluid (electrolyte). On board a ship, the electrical power is after that drawn out from the fluid as well as utilized to thrust the ship. The released electrolyte is after that traded for billed electrolyte as well as the released electrolyte is charged.
